If Sony SRS-RA3000 is compatible with AMP?

Willing to buy Sony Speakers #SRS-RA3000 which has Voice assistant and Bluetooth and Wifi (compatible with Google Home group-multi room).

How do I know if it will be compatible with my Sonos AMP?

Best answer by ratty

Sonos players don’t interwork with smart speakers from other manufacturers in terms of playing together in sync. However the Google Assistant on another speaker could be used to control Sonos devices. https://support.sonos.com/s/article/3486

 

In certain cases an analog connection can be made into a Sonos Line-In, depending on the capabilities of the third party device. The Sony SRS-RA3000 has just an analog input, not an output. It therefore can’t be directly connected to your Amp.
